Understanding the 250-300TPH Crusher
A 250-300TPH medium hard rock and construction waste crusher is a heavy-duty machine designed to crush and process medium hard rocks as well as construction debris. With a capacity range of 250 to 300 tons per hour (TPH), this type of crusher is ideal for larger construction sites and quarries. The machine efficiently breaks down materials into smaller, more manageable forms such as gravel or sand.
Key Features and Components
-
Robust Design: Built with a durable frame and heavy-duty components, this crusher can handle the rigors of heavy use.
-
Optimized Jaw and Cone Crushers: These components work together to ensure efficient crushing and size reduction of medium hard rocks and construction waste.
-
Advanced Automation: Many models include automated systems that adjust the crusher settings for optimal performance, improving both efficiency and safety.
-
Mobility: Some crushers are mobile, allowing them to be easily transported to different sites, which increases their adaptability.
Benefits of Using a 250-300TPH Crusher
Improved Site Efficiency
Operating with a large throughput capacity, these crushers streamline operations by quickly reducing the size of construction waste and hard rock. This means less time spent on processing and more time devoted to completing the project on schedule.
Cost-Effective Waste Management
By crushing and reusing construction waste onsite, this machine significantly reduces the need for purchasing new raw materials and minimizes disposal costs. Recycled materials can be repurposed for future construction, contributing to budget optimization.
Environmental Sustainability
Utilizing a crusher to process construction waste reduces the environmental impact by decreasing landfill use and promoting the recycling of materials. It supports sustainable construction practices, aligning with global efforts to reduce carbon footprints.
Enhanced Material Versatility
Whether working with medium hard rock, construction debris, or a combination of both, this crusher provides consistent output suitable for various applications. From road base to backfill material, the versatility it offers enhances construction versatility.
Factors to Consider When Selecting a Crusher
-
Project Requirements: Understand the specific needs in terms of material type and output size to choose the most suitable crusher.
-
Mobility Needs: Assess whether a mobile crusher is necessary based on the site's scale and scope of the project.
-
Budget and Cost: Factor in the initial purchase cost, operational costs, and potential savings from reduced waste and recycled materials.
-
Technical Support and Maintenance: Select a manufacturer or supplier offering robust after-sales support to maintain optimal machine performance.
